The proposal entails the construction of a ten-storey residential apartment building located at 776 and 784 St. Laurent Boulevard, in the City of Ottawa.
The subject site is located on the west side of St. Laurent Boulevard, between Cote Street and Guy Street. The irregular shaped lot is 1,497m2 in size, with 52.02 metres of frontage on St. Laurent Boulevard.
In keeping with the intent of the Arterial Mainstreet designation and zoning for this portion of St. Laurent Boulevard, the proposal entails redeveloping the Subject Site and constructing a higher density apartment dwelling. The apartment dwelling will be ten-storeys, with a total of 87 residential dwelling units. The development will feature a mix of one and two-bedroom units of different sizes to appeal to a variety of potential tenants.
Vehicular access to the proposed development will be from Cote Street. A shared, double lane driveway will be located on the abutting property to the west of the Subject Site, municipally known as 550 Cote Street. This shared driveway will provide access to shared surface parking as well as two-levels of underground parking. A total of 148 spaces will be provided, with 98 spaces located in the underground parking garage and 50 spaces located at grade. A total of 48 indoor bicycle parking spaces are proposed within the parking garage. Pedestrian accesses for residents will be provided along St. Laurent Boulevard as well as at the rear of the building.
The proposal includes demolishing the existing detached dwellings and constructing a ten-storey residential apartment building.
